Western Union to acquire Intermex for about $500 million
Aug 10, 2025 8:38 PM

Aug 10 (Reuters) - Money transfer company Western Union ( WU )

said on Sunday it will acquire Intermex, a U.S.

firm that focuses on payment transfers to Latin America and the

Caribbean, for about $500 million in cash.

Western Union ( WU ) will pay $16 for each Intermex share,

representing a premium of over 70% to Intermex's last close of

$9.28 on Friday.

Western Union ( WU ), among the world's top providers of money

transfer services, said the deal was expected to add to its

adjusted earnings per share by more than $0.10 in the first full

year after close.

The company added that the deal would help it expand in the

"historically high-growth Latin America geographies."

In the first quarter of 2025, Intermex said it will

discontinue issuing quarterly guidance. The company also cut its

annual forecasts for profit and revenue, citing economic

uncertainty.

(Reporting by Harshita Meenaktshi in Bengaluru; Editing by

Muralikumar Anantharaman)
